“五四”运动爆发后,天津爱国青年学生迅速响应,从1919年5月5日开始,南开大学、北洋大学等学校的学生纷纷走出校门,集会演讲,游行示威,声援北京学生的正义斗争,22岁的周恩来一从日本回国就立即投入了这场轰轰烈烈的斗争。15日,天津学生联合会正式成立,领导全市学生开展了一系列反帝爱国运动,周恩来担任《天津学生联合会报》主编。11月16日,日本帝国主义公然制造了“福州惨案”后,天津再次掀起反对日本帝国主义暴行、抵制日货的爱国高潮。1920年1月23日,天津学生联合会日货调查员在东门内魁发成洋广杂货铺调查私运日货时,遭到日本浪人的毒打,警察厅非但不惩办奸商和凶手,反而于翌日出动军警殴打逮捕了马骏、马千里等20多名示威请愿学生和各界联合会代表,并查封了天津学生联合会和天津各界联合会。反动当局的这一罪恶行径激怒了周恩来、于兰渚(于方舟)等爱国学生,于是,29日,在周恩来、于兰渚的领导下,五六千名学生走上街头,浩浩荡荡地向省长公署进发……
